Comprehensive Guide to Glass Repair for Doors
Glass doors are popular choices for contemporary homes and businesses, providing visual appeal and allowing natural light to improve interior areas. Nevertheless, their fragility can lead to the need for repairs due to numerous factors, including effects, climate condition, and even progressive wear and tear. This post will explore the necessary aspects of glass door repair, covering the types of damage, repair procedures, costs, and maintenance tips, making it a valuable resource for house owners and company owner alike.
Types of Damage to Glass Doors
Recognizing the kind of damage is crucial to figuring out the appropriate repair technique. The following table sums up the most typical kinds of damage related to glass doors:
Type of DamageDescriptionFracturesVisible cracks that can vary in length and depth, often caused by impacts.ChipsLittle pieces of glass that have been cracked away, usually at the edges of the glass.ScratchesMinor surface damage that affects the glass's aesthetics but not its structural stability.ShatteringThe total damage of the glass, necessitating complete replacement.FoggingThe buildup of moisture in between Double glazing repairers-glazed panes, decreasing presence.Typical Causes of Glass Door Damage
Glass doors can sustain damage for various reasons, some of that include:
Accidental impacts: This is the most typical cause of damage, typically resulting from children playing, animals, or perhaps furnishings being moved.Climate condition: Extreme temperature levels and storms can deteriorate the integrity of glass, causing fractures or shattering.Incorrect installation: Poorly installed glass doors may not fit correctly or line up well, increasing the probability of damage.Aging: Over time, seals around glass doors might weaken, resulting in issues like fogging or leak.The Glass Door Repair Process
Repairing a glass door differs based upon the kind of damage and might require professional intervention. Below are some normal procedures:
Step 1: Assess the Damage
Before continuing with any repair, it is necessary to assess the extent of the damage. For minor problems like chips and scratches, you might be able to perform repairs yourself, however for severe damage, such as fractures or shattering, it is a good idea to seek advice from an expert.
Step 2: Gather Necessary Tools and Materials
If you prepare to try small repairs, prepare the following materials:
Glass cleanerSoft cloth or spongeEpoxy resin (for chips and cracks)Glass repair set (for bigger problems)Safety gloves and eyewearStep 3: Perform RepairsMinor RepairsChips and Scratches: Clean the area with a glass cleaner and a soft fabric. Apply epoxy or an appropriate repair kit according to the producer's guidelines. Ensure a smooth finish.Cracks: Similar to chips, tidy the area, apply a repair adhesive, and enable it to treat appropriately.Major Repairs
For larger fractures or complete shattering:
Safety Precautions: Wear safety equipment to safeguard against broken glass.Eliminate Broken Glass: Carefully remove any shattered pieces. Usage duct tape to get little fragments.Changing Glass: An expert may need to measure the door frame and cut new glass to size. Guarantee correct sealing and fitting.Step 4: Final Cleaning
After repairs, tidy the glass with a suitable cleaner to eliminate any residue from repair materials.
Costs of Glass Door Repair
The expense of repairing a glass door can vary substantially based on the damage's level and place. Here is a basic breakdown of prospective costs:
Type of RepairTypical Cost Range (GBP)Minor repairs (chips, scratches)50 - 150Break repairs50 - 200Expert full panel replacement200 - 600
Note: Prices can vary depending on products used, labor costs, and geographical area.
Maintenance Tips for Glass Doors
To prolong the life of glass doors and lessen the need for repairs, consider the following maintenance pointers:
Regular Cleaning: Clean the glass often to eliminate dust and grime, which can affect clarity.Examine Seals: Inspect weather condition seals routinely for wear and change them as required to avoid moisture buildup.Prevent Slamming: Encourage gentle usage of glass doors to reduce the threat of unexpected effects.Display Temperature Changes: Be mindful of extreme temperature modifications that can put stress on glass.Frequently Asked Questions About Glass Door Repairs
1. How can I inform if my glass door needs to be replaced?If you observe
considerable cracks, large chips, or if the glass has shattered, it is typically more reliable and more secure to change the door instead of trying a repair.

2. Can I repair a foggy double-glazed door?While some DIY techniques
exist, misting normally requires professional attention, typically involving resealing or changing the sealed system. 3. Is glass repair covered by homeowners insurance?Coverage typically depends on the cause of the damage. Consult your insurance supplier to
understand your policy's specifics. 4. Can I do my glass door repairs?For small problems like scratches and chips, it is feasible to attempt repairs as a DIY job. Nevertheless, bigger issues ought to be dealt with by professionals for safety factors. Repairing glass doors is a task that, while often intimidating, is workable with the best method and info.
